Customizable Fake Infection
Ever felt like fake infections are not challenging enough but playing with mortality is to scary?
Well fear no more! Customizable Fake Infection comes with a lot of settings to tweak fake infections to your heart's content.

Settings
Moodles
Moodles to keep track of which stage you're currently in.

Infection Speed
Control how quickly you want the infection to rise until it reaches it's peak!
This setting is tied to your day length.

Immersive Pain
You can add additional pain to a specific bodypart.
Choose either head, upper- or lower chest.

Pick a dice
You can pick a dice to randomize the initial start of the infection and even change the randomized value!

Health Regeneration
If you want aid to sustain through the stages of the infection you can specify a threshold and a value for the health regeneration.

4 Stages
Set healthloss, pain, wetness, hunger, thirst or endurance.
Enable or disable each stage as you feel and change the values to your liking.

Vanilla Mortality Setting
Set your mortality to anything other then INSTANT or NEVER.
